This Sheboygan Matcha Retreat Includes Pottery, Yoga, Brunch, and a Chance to Slow Down
If your schedule has felt nonstop lately, this upcoming event in downtown Sheboygan might be exactly the reset you need.
On May 16 from 9:30 AM to 1:30 PM, The Sheboygan Collective is partnering with Sora Matcha for a half-day retreat built around creativity, mindfulness, and intentional rest.
And this is not your typical workshop. Attendees will spend the morning moving through multiple experiences designed to help them slow down and reconnect.
Create Your Own Ceramic Matcha Bowl
Guests will begin by hand-building their own ceramic matcha bowl with guidance from The Sheboygan Collective team.
You’ll learn simple clay techniques while creating something functional that you can use long after the event is over. Your bowl will stay at the studio afterward to be fired and glazed, and participants will be notified when it is ready for pickup.
Learn How to Prepare Matcha with Intention
Sora Matcha will lead a guided matcha workshop where guests will learn the basics of preparing matcha and participate in a tasting experience.
This portion of the retreat focuses on slowing down and appreciating the ritual behind matcha preparation rather than rushing through another coffee run.
Choose Your Own Wellness Experience
One of the most unique parts of this retreat is that guests can choose the activity that feels right for them.
You can join a gentle yoga session or participate in a meditative art journaling experience. Both options are designed to help attendees stay present and create space for intentional rest.
Brunch by KBee Bakery
Halfway through the retreat, guests will gather for brunch prepared by KBee Bakery. This gives everyone time to relax, connect, and enjoy meaningful conversation while taking a break from the activities.
Who This Event Is Perfect For
This event is ideal for anyone who has been craving a slower pace. It would make a great solo self-care day, a girls outing, or something fun to do with a friend if you want to try something different in Sheboygan.
The best part is that you do not need any prior experience with pottery, yoga, journaling, or matcha. Everything is beginner-friendly. Just bring comfortable clothing if you plan to do yoga and a water bottle. Yoga mats will be provided.
